Bilenke ( Ukrainian Біленьке ; Russian Беленькое Belenkoje ) is an urban-type settlement in the north of the Ukrainian Donetsk Oblast with about 9400 inhabitants (as of 2014).

From an administrative point of view, Bilenke belongs to the urban district of the city of Kramatorsk and borders on its urban area in the south. The village received urban-type settlement status on November 15, 1938 and is located on the Bilenkij River ( Біленькій ), a tributary of the Kasennyj Torez about 105 km north of the Oblast capital Donetsk . The N 20 road runs to the west of the village . The settlement is the center of a settlement council, which also includes the Wassyliwska Pustosch ( Василівська Пустош ) settlement with around 200 inhabitants.
